Cellular Operators

AIS

APN settings

  • username: (blank)
  • password: (blank)
  • APN name: internet

DTAC

APN settings

  • username: (blank)
  • password: (blank)
  • APN name: www.dtac.co.th


Prepaid data plans

General Information about Prepaid data plans

SIM cards and top-ups are available widely in Thailand from the major carriers (DTAC, True and AIS) as well as a number of smaller 'boutique' provides that lease government bandwidth and equipment. Purchase of a new sim card/number is easy, and can be done at any 7-11 as well as at many airport kiosks. In the Southern regions, registration and the production of ID (such as passport for non-Thais) may be required.

DTAC

Happy Internet Packages

Monthly Packages

Package Service Fee
20 hrs. 99 baht/ $3.3
50 hrs. 199 baht/ $6.5
140 hrs. 399 baht/ $13
Unlimited 999 baht/ $33

Daily Packages

Package Service Fee
1 day 49 baht/ $1.6
7 day 249 baht/ $8.2
How to activate
  • Via Automatic Voice center. Dial 1004 – Dial 1 (free of charge)
  • Via Automatic Voice center. Dial 1888 (free of charge)
  • Via DTAC Call Center - Dial 1678 press 7 (3 Baht/call)


How to top up
Where to buy

Can be purchased from DTAC Shops which are located in most major shopping malls and city centers across the country.


Sim Sizes
  • Regular Sim available and is known as "Happy Internet"
  • Microsim available and is known as "Happy MicroSim"
More information

Users can begin to access the Internet once they have received a confirmation SMS within 1 hour of applying. For more information call the DTAC Call Center at 1678, press 7 for English. More information at Happy Internet Site (English)
